Transaction 77e046af3c35ef288a186580f803bc6d5622fb3e14b9f1ce37117e12c4588eb9
1 Input
1 Output
-
77e046af3c35ef288a186580f803bc6d5622fb3e14b9f1ce37117e12c4588eb9:0
- value
- 38591400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5aeb8a4468091568b0bd2e8051a41893928504d OP_EQUAL
- address
- 3JFfY7NyWgaN71Zq5nHahf55f3WLzEuT23